Update CI to Ubuntu 24.04 (#8109)

Fixes #7775
This commit is contained in:
James Renken 2025-04-16 17:32:55 -04:00 committed by GitHub
parent b2eaabb4e1
commit 23e14f1149
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
3 changed files with 5 additions and 5 deletions

View File

@ -16,7 +16,7 @@ jobs:
matrix:
GO_VERSION:
- "1.24.1"
runs-on: ubuntu-20.04
runs-on: ubuntu-24.04
permissions:
contents: write
packages: write

View File

@ -17,7 +17,7 @@ jobs:
matrix:
GO_VERSION:
- "1.24.1"
runs-on: ubuntu-20.04
runs-on: ubuntu-24.04
steps:
- uses: actions/checkout@v4
with:

View File

@ -1,5 +1,5 @@
# syntax=docker/dockerfile:1
FROM buildpack-deps:focal-scm as godeps
FROM buildpack-deps:noble-scm as godeps
ARG GO_VERSION
# Provided automatically by docker build.
ARG TARGETPLATFORM
@ -17,7 +17,7 @@ RUN go install github.com/golangci/golangci-lint/cmd/golangci-lint@v1.64.0
RUN go install honnef.co/go/tools/cmd/staticcheck@2025.1
RUN go install github.com/jsha/minica@v1.1.0
FROM rust:bullseye as rustdeps
FROM rust:latest as rustdeps
# Provided automatically by docker build.
ARG TARGETPLATFORM
ARG BUILDPLATFORM
@ -31,7 +31,7 @@ RUN /tmp/build-rust-deps.sh
# more information.
#
# Run this command in each container: dpkg -l libc6
FROM buildpack-deps:focal-scm
FROM buildpack-deps:noble-scm
# Provided automatically by docker build.
ARG TARGETPLATFORM
ARG BUILDPLATFORM